Fiesta Meatloaf

  • Minutes to Prepare:
  • Minutes to Cook:
  • Number of Servings: 6
Ingredients
½ cup chopped onion½ cup chopped celery½ cup chopped green pepper3 tsp. butter or margarine1 bottle Heinz chili sauce (12 oz.) 1 lb. lean ground beef1 cup soft bread crumbs (Progresso)1 egg, slightly beaten½ tsp. salt1/8 tsp. pepper (more or less to taste, recipe calculated with 1/2 tsp.)
Directions
Sauté onion, celery and green pepper in butter until vegetables are tender. Stir in chili sauce. Combine ½ cup of this mixture with ground beef, bread crumbs, egg, salt and pepper. Form into a loaf in shallow baking pan. Bake in 350 degrees oven for 1 hour. Serve remaining sauce, cold or heated, over meat loaf. Let stand 5 minutes before slicing. Makes 6 servings.
